About The Position

Ardurra is seeking an experienced Senior Project Manager - Transportation (PE) to join our growing Transportation team, in Everett, WA. This position will lead the planning, management, and delivery of transportation infrastructure projects for public sector clients including State DOTs, counties, municipalities, transit agencies, and local agencies. The ideal candidate will bring strong project delivery experience, established client relationships, and a proven background leading transportation programs and multidisciplinary teams. This role will focus on project execution, client management, strategic growth, and transportation infrastructure development.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Civil Engineering or similar
  • Active Professional Engineer (PE) license in Washington State required (or ability to obtain)
  • Minimum 12+ years of transportation engineering and project management experience
  • Previous experience serving as Project Manager or Senior Project Manager
  • Experience managing transportation infrastructure projects for DOT, municipal, county, transit, and public agency clients
  • Demonstrated client management, project delivery, and business development experience
  • Experience managing project budgets, schedules, staffing plans, contracts, and multidisciplinary teams
  • Strong understanding of transportation planning, traffic engineering, roadway design, and project delivery methods
  • Strong leadership, communication, presentation, and relationship management skills

Responsibilities

  • Serve as Senior Project Manager and primary client contact for transportation projects and programs
  • Lead project delivery for roadway, transportation, traffic, and multimodal infrastructure projects
  • Manage project scope, schedules, budgets, staffing plans, and overall project execution and delivery
  • Develop and maintain relationships with DOTs, municipalities, transit agencies, and public sector clients
  • Support business development activities including pursuits, proposals, interviews, and strategic growth initiatives
  • Coordinate multidisciplinary teams including transportation planning, traffic engineering, roadway design, drainage, utilities, structures, and environmental services
  • Oversee QA/QC efforts and technical delivery across project teams
  • Mentor and supervise project managers, engineers, and technical staff
  • Support corridor planning, multimodal transportation initiatives, and transportation improvement programs
  • Participate in strategic planning and market expansion activities
